Master Key Set — Transfer Procedure. Heads up: the full master key set for the Brackwell sites moves between offices on the first Monday of each month. Keys travel in the sealed grey pouch only, never loose, and the pouch log gets initialled both ends. Ring ahead so someone's actually at the desk. When the courier takes the pouch, state the following exactly:

dispatch memo: the eliath belael courier leaves the praox ledger at gate 8841 under passcode 017589

## Break-Glass Access — Twigsweep Bot

Twigsweep, the stale-branch cleanup bot for the Marrowvale monorepo, occasionally deletes a branch someone still needed. Support staff may invoke break-glass restore, which bypasses the normal approval queue. Use it only after confirming the requester owns the branch, and record the incident in the access log. The break-glass console will prompt for the recovery passphrase, which is provided below.

vault phrase of tawip-faweg = fraok-holdor-zorwyn-belox-ulador-aldix-quenael-lamox-juleth-lamion

- [ ] **Step 7: Breaker override escrow.** After sealing the signing keys for the Tallgrove upstream API circuit breaker, confirm the support team can force the breaker open during a full outage. The override bundle lives in the sealed escrow drawer and is useless without its unlock phrase. Two ceremony witnesses must initial this step before proceeding. The escrow bundle is decrypted with the recovery passphrase that follows.

vault phrase of kahip-kahop = holath-quenmir

## Who to ping about GiftNote

Welcome aboard! GiftNote is our donation-receipt mailer for the Larchfield Fund. Template tweaks go to the comms folks; delivery failures and bounce weirdness go to the platform crew. Don't push template changes on Fridays — receipts batch over the weekend. For anything GiftNote-related, start with the address below.

billing contact of kaweg-tajeg = drudor.lamion.oliath@torvalabs.test